About
"Comprises 25 articles which the author has published on the Project Syndicate website since 2012. These articles are grouped into four broad topics: (1) Growth and Structural Adjustment, (2) Economic Integration and Cooperation, (3) Business, Money, and Finance, and (4) Education and Society. Through these selected works, the author explores whether the Asian Century is coming to pass or not and how Asian economies prepare for such century. The author also presents his analyses of Asia's economic transformation as well as social and cultural changes, and suggests the ways that Asian economies can overcome major economic and social challenges to continue their path towards a more balanced and sustainable growth in the 21st century. This book serves as a useful reference text for those who seek to understand the Asian economies, and contributes to ongoing policy debate on Asia's economic future"--
